Transaction e341bbdb0146ab71e8303c6f4ef70ef47898c70de2a6e2ac31114174af143134

1 Input
2 Outputs
  • e341bbdb0146ab71e8303c6f4ef70ef47898c70de2a6e2ac31114174af143134:0
  • value  667129
    address  3HuVB8joEeka6u61CZQMqU7eVuxvw2JhSk
  • e341bbdb0146ab71e8303c6f4ef70ef47898c70de2a6e2ac31114174af143134:1
  • value  108953452
    address  1ETFJihKNb5Sx2SQEVj642By59EZNfBZgV